Which pair shows equivalent expressions?
A.2(2/5x + 2)=2 2/5x + 1
B.2(2/5x + 2)=4/5x + 4
C.2(2/5x + 4)=4/5x + 2
D.2(2/5x + 4)=2 2/5x + 8
Solution:

Let us distribute 2 inside the parenthesis.
That is, we use distributive property:
a(b+c)=ab+ac

So, 
Answer:Option (b)

Applying distributive property, a(b+c)=ab+ac



So, Option (B) is correct.
